Timeless Diva: Anita Mui|Exhibition Introduction

Creating countless legends, Anita Mui was always a shining icon of Hong Kong’s pop culture on the international stage. She made a lasting impression with her unique voice and solid singing skills. With her unconventional music style and versatile images, Anita Mui led Hong Kong’s music scene, taking Cantopop to new heights and setting a new benchmark for concert culture. On the silver screen, she played one after another classic characters with her unique personal charm and sophisticated acting skills. Named “Best Actress” at the Hong Kong Film Awards, Golden Horse Awards and Asia-Pacific Film Festival for her performance in Rogue, she bore testimony to the heyday of Hong Kong cinema in the 1980s and 1990s. Time certainly flies, but the trendsetting “Ever-changing Diva” continues to influence people across generations with her timeless works.
This exhibition commemorates the 20th anniversary of Anita Mui’s passing. Through her records, stage costumes, films, and pop culture products, we will reminisce about the superstar’s extraordinary achievements in music and film industry, while looking back at her brilliant contribution to Hong Kong’s pop culture.
Exhibit Highlights

Trophy for the TBS Award of the 12th Tokyo Music Festival
1983, Donated by Mr Eddie Lau, Collection of the Hong Kong Heritage Museum

Autographed vinyl record of Fair Lady by Anita Mui
1989, Courtesy of Mr Michael Cheng

Stage costume worn by Anita Mui when she performed Evil Girl and other fast-beat songs at Anita Mui in Concert in 1987-1988
1987, Donated by Mr Eddie Lau, Collection of the Hong Kong Heritage Museum

Stage costume worn by Anita Mui when she received the Golden Needle Award at Radio Television Hong Kong’s 21st Top Ten Chinese Gold Songs Award Concert in 1998
1998, Donated by Mr Eddie Lau, Collection of the Hong Kong Heritage Museum

Stage costume worn by Anita Mui for the grand finale of the last show of Anita Mui Fantasy Gig in 2002
2002, Donated by Mr Eddie Lau, Collection of the Hong Kong Heritage Museum
